SWAN VIEW vs COCKBURN - Swan View kicked off their season as most thought they would against TA's with a win,although the margin was quite big. Cockburn on the other hand narrowly went down at home to last seasons fellow strugglers in Roleystone. They would be wanting to get an early win on the board but they may have wait another week. If the Cobras get off to a slow start it could be a long day. The View by 6 goals. Ressies- The View by a goal.

ROLEYSTONE vs WEMBLEY - Roly got an early confidence boost with an away win over the Cobras while Wembley lost to Ozzy Park. With this ground being played on a postage stamp most would expect it to favour the home side but I think it will also suit the bigger Wembley bodies who won't have to cover as much ground. I'm predicting an arm wrestle with the more seasoned Wembley to get up by a goal. Roly by a goal in ressies.

BRENTWOOD vs TA's - The Woods easily accounted for The River 1st up and will be looking to keep pace with The View at the top of the table early on. TA's would've been mighty disappointed with last weeks performance after last years undefeated run and will be looking to bounce back. I'm sure they will put up a better performance but with Brentwood being back home I'd say they will win comfortably,6 goals. Ressies-TA's by 2 goals.

OSBORNE PARK vs SECRET HARBOUR - GOTR- Both teams started theirs seasons well against teams I think will battle for a spot in the 5. This game will tell us a fair bit about each side. Will The Park have a more settled line up this year and will The Shockers be able to travel. Simply because its at home ill tip the Park,by 3 goals. Ressies- park by a goal.

JANDAKOT vs SOUTHER RIVER - Both teams looking to get their seasons on track after a disappointing start. It may be early on but if either team is going to make the 5 then they can't afford to lose these kind of games with tougher opponents to come. Should be a desperate and willing contest but I think Jandakot at home with a little more depth will get the job done,3 goals. Ressies- Jandy by a goal
